    Data Frame

    Data frame is made up by 4 parts, shown as below.

    2 Command Set

    DGUS Register Space: 0x00H-0xFFH, is written / read by byte.

    DGUS Variable Data Memory Space: 0x0000H-0x6FFFH, is written / read by word.

    Data in Curve buffer is written / read by word.

    The communication between DGUS LCMs & Controllers (MCU) are driven by Variables that you may read andwrite in corresponding address.

    3 Curve Display

    There are two methods to display the curve:

    Dynamic-curve Display

    Basic Graphic Display

    3.1 Dynamic-curve Display

    3.1.1 Display Dynamic curve in the different areas

    Add the dynamic-curve display functions in the different areas. The data source channels should be different.

    You can display up to 8 dynamic-curves at the same time.

    3.1.3 Send Curve Data to the Data Source Channel

    Send:

    5A A5 12 84 12 00 3200 7200 9F00 0400 1700 3600 9300 1A

    Description:

    5A A5 : Frame header.

    12: Data length from 84 to 1A

    84: Command for Writing Curve

    12: Channel 4 & Channel 1, 8bit(00010010)

    00 32: Data in channel 1

    00 72: Data in channel 4

    3.1.4 Reset Dynamic curve

    Step 1: Update the kernel to DGUS_V5.5 or above

    Please contact our sales to get the latest firmware. For steps on update refer to the chapter 1.4 of DGUS

    Development Guide.

    Step 2: Write commands to DGUS register to clear the curves.

    Register Address Definition Length(Byte) Description

    0xEB Trendline_Clear 1

    Write a special value to clear the data of corresponding

    channels.

    0x55: Clear the whole dynamic curve data buffer.

    0x56-0x5D: Clear the data of channels respectively from

    CH0 to CH7.

    After clearing the dynamic curves, this register will be reset.

    For example,

    Clear all channels

    5A A5 03 80 EB 55

    5A A5 : Frame header.

    03: Data length from 80 to 55

    80: Command for writing data into DGUS register

    EB: Register Address

    55: The special value for clearing the whole dynamic curve data buffer

    Clear the special curve

    5A A5 03 80 EB 5A

    5A A5 : Frame header.

    03: Data length from 80 to 5A

    80: Command for writing data into DGUS register

    EB: Register Address

    5A: The special value for clearing the data of channel 4.
